  1. They are confident but there is a lot of politics currently that are pushed by the government here that paints Hungary as a global leader in everything. Rationality is in small supply in many areas of the country. In reality they have one great player, a few decent and at least half a team that wouldn't get into our first choice 11. Szoboszlai will be a threat and potentially a match winning one. He is their Bale, a great player who raises it even further playing for his country. Tbh I'm hoping a first full season in the premiership will dent him by the euros. Like us they miss a striker and they have some absolute guff in their squad. They are well enough organised and motivated overall though. I have watched them a few times when they don't clash with us. No injuries playing to their best I'd personally expect us to beat them but we all know the group and games will be tight.
